Police Foil Attempt to Smuggle Stolen Motorcycles to Jambi

The Metro Jaya Regional Police have successfully thwarted an attempt to smuggle stolen motorcycles to Jambi. Following an investigation, the recovered motorcycles have been returned to their rightful owners. This operation is part of the ongoing 'Operasi Berantas Jaya 2026' initiative, which aims to combat criminal activities. The police are committed to ensuring public safety and recovering stolen property. The successful interception highlights the effectiveness of the ongoing law enforcement efforts in the region. Further details on the number of motorcycles or individuals involved were not immediately available. The initiative underscores the continued focus on dismantling criminal networks and preventing the illicit trade of stolen goods. The police assure the public that such operations will continue to be conducted to maintain order and security.
